A community taskforce has been meeting since summer 2007 and recently released a report with a set of recommendations concerning alternative education to the DPS school board.

The Donnell-Kay Foundation released a blueprint for DPS to create a high perfoming school district, including guidance on the formation of new schools.

What We Are Doing

  • Coming Together - Youth come together to organize their energy and resources toward returning to school.
  • Changing Our Mindsets - Youth participate in life-changing activities, such as tutoring younger youth, presenting at educational conferences, and taking college classes in order to to see themselves and their education from a different perspective.
  • Speaking Up for Ourselves - Building upon the knowledge gained through school experience, youth learn to be their own best advocates and how to get the most out of their education.
  • Returning to School - Youth do research, interview students and teachers, and investigate school programs to make informed choices upon returning to school.
  • Succeeding in School - Youth engage in academic catch-up activities, mentoring, homework labs, and support groups to increase their success in school.
  • Reaching out and Inspiring Others to Return to School - Youth returning to school reach out to out-of-school youth in their neighborhoods to inspire them to return to school.
